A Jamaican patty is a golden-yellow semicircular pastry where a flaky, folded shell gives way to savory fillings—traditionally seasoned ground beef, though chicken, goat, shrimp, or vegetables work too. The heat comes from Scotch bonnets, thyme, oregano, and garlic, creating a spiced parcel that's substantial enough to eat as a full meal or small enough to slip into your pocket as a snack. Pair it with coco bread and you've got the Jamaican way; eat it alone and you still get the point.

What makes this version distinct

A Jamaican patty is a semicircular pastry that contains various fillings and spices baked inside a flaky shell, often tinted golden yellow with an egg yolk mixture, annatto or turmeric. It is a type of turnover, and is formed by folding the circular dough cutout over the chosen filling, but is savoury and filled with ground meat. As its name suggests, it is commonly found inside Jamaica, and is also eaten in other areas of the Caribbean including the Caribbean coast of Nicaragua, Costa Rica and Panama. It is traditionally filled with seasoned ground beef, but other fillings include chicken, pork, lamb, goat, vegetables, shrimp, lobster, fish, soy, ackee, callaloo, bacon or cheese. Jamaican patties are typically seasoned with onions, garlic, thyme, oregano and chili peppers. The use of the Scotch bonnet, a hot pepper indigenous to Jamaica, adds flavour to the patty.
